Ever wonder why your walls are showing signs of cracks or why doors are suddenly sticking in your Potomac home? The answer often lies beneath your feet, in the fundamental interplay between the local environment and your home's foundation. In this region, soil is influenced by fluctuating moisture levels, leading to phenomena like soil expansion and contraction. In areas with clay-heavy soil, typical in some Potomac neighborhoods, these changes are especially pronounced. High groundwater levels and the area's seasonal freeze-thaw cycles can exacerbate these effects, causing soil to shift. Such movement can place stress on the structural elements of your home, leading to noticeable settling over time.
When soil shifts beneath your home, it can lead to issues with your foundation, basement walls, or crawl space. This stress often manifests as uneven floors, wall cracks, or persistent water pooling—early signs that shouldn't be overlooked. Monitoring these signs can help prevent severe damage, as catching problems early allows for more manageable repairs. Homes in Potomac are particularly susceptible due to their environmental conditions, making regular checks essential. Understanding how your home interacts with its surroundings is key to maintaining a sound structure and avoiding costly repairs in the future.
